Who We Are

While we are not a large Congregation, the Board of Directors has plans to enhance membership and programs. We are looking for members who wish to become part of the local Jewish Community. Services are conducted by Hazzan Laurie Rimland-Bonn and Cantor Isaac Kriger.
Hazzan Laurie is the spiritual Leader of the congregation and has instituted adult education classes and adult Bar/Bat Mitzvah classes.
Cantor Kriger is assisted by his wife Liz on the keyboard and she also adds her voice to many of the traditional melodies. These two voices present an awe inspiring service.
In addition to a Sisterhood group, a Men's Club has also been started. Both these groups are involved in charitable works and synagogue maintenance.
